Thanks for your direction - it’s fixed thanks to support.
I’ll share, because it might happen again:
Device: iPhone 17
OS: iOS 26.3.1, which auto-updated early last week (if I recall)
Bitwarden Authenticator v.: 2026.2.1(497), which updated only a couple days ago WHILE it wasn’t working)
tech support asked me a question which had the solution in it: is FaceID used with Authenticator?
That was it.
I didn’t think of it, because FaceID doesn’t work well for me and I don’t enable it on most things. I also keep turning off Apple intelligence. I found both of these enabled for Authenticator. I do not know for sure, but this began with the iOS update so they were possibly re-enabled or I agreed to do so thoughtlessly when prompted after the phone rebooted.
Anyway. turned of FaceID and Apple intel, Authenticator working fine! Now exporting it, just in case it’s more broken next time.
